[BACK]Return to Makefile C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/ pkgsrc / misc / todoman

Annotation of pkgsrc/misc/todoman/Makefile, Revision 1.12

1.12    ! wiz         1: # $NetBSD: Makefile,v 1.11 2017/05/04 22:48:24 wiz Exp $
1.1       wiz         2:
1.12    ! wiz         3: DISTNAME=      todoman-3.2.0
1.1       wiz         4: CATEGORIES=    misc
                      5: MASTER_SITES=  ${MASTER_SITE_PYPI:=t/todoman/}
                      6:
                      7: MAINTAINER=    pkgsrc-users@NetBSD.org
                      8: HOMEPAGE=      https://github.com/pimutils/todoman
                      9: COMMENT=       Simple CalDav-based todo manager
                     10: LICENSE=       mit
                     11:
                     12: DEPENDS+=      ${PYPKGPREFIX}-atomicwrites-[0-9]*:../../devel/py-atomicwrites
1.8       wiz        13: DEPENDS+=      ${PYPKGPREFIX}-click>=6.0:../../devel/py-click
                     14: DEPENDS+=      ${PYPKGPREFIX}-click-log-[0-9]*:../../devel/py-click-log
1.5       wiz        15: DEPENDS+=      ${PYPKGPREFIX}-configobj-[0-9]*:../../devel/py-configobj
                     16: DEPENDS+=      ${PYPKGPREFIX}-dateutil-[0-9]*:../../time/py-dateutil
1.8       wiz        17: DEPENDS+=      ${PYPKGPREFIX}-humanize-[0-9]*:../../textproc/py-humanize
1.1       wiz        18: DEPENDS+=      ${PYPKGPREFIX}-icalendar-[0-9]*:../../time/py-icalendar
                     19: DEPENDS+=      ${PYPKGPREFIX}-parsedatetime-[0-9]*:../../time/py-parsedatetime
1.8       wiz        20: DEPENDS+=      ${PYPKGPREFIX}-tabulate-[0-9]*:../../textproc/py-tabulate
1.1       wiz        21: DEPENDS+=      ${PYPKGPREFIX}-urwid-[0-9]*:../../devel/py-urwid
                     22: DEPENDS+=      ${PYPKGPREFIX}-xdg-[0-9]*:../../devel/py-xdg
1.5       wiz        23: BUILD_DEPENDS+=        ${PYPKGPREFIX}-setuptools_scm-[0-9]*:../../devel/py-setuptools_scm
1.11      wiz        24: BUILD_DEPENDS+=        ${PYPKGPREFIX}-test-runner-[0-9]*:../../devel/py-test-runner
1.9       wiz        25:
1.1       wiz        26: # TEST_DEPENDS
1.9       wiz        27: BUILD_DEPENDS+=        ${PYPKGPREFIX}-flake8-[0-9]*:../../devel/py-flake8
                     28: BUILD_DEPENDS+=        ${PYPKGPREFIX}-flake8-import-order-[0-9]*:../../devel/py-flake8-import-order
1.6       wiz        29: BUILD_DEPENDS+=        ${PYPKGPREFIX}-freezegun-[0-9]*:../../devel/py-freezegun
1.1       wiz        30: BUILD_DEPENDS+=        ${PYPKGPREFIX}-hypothesis-[0-9]*:../../devel/py-hypothesis
                     31: BUILD_DEPENDS+=        ${PYPKGPREFIX}-test-[0-9]*:../../devel/py-test
1.9       wiz        32: BUILD_DEPENDS+=        ${PYPKGPREFIX}-test-cov-[0-9]*:../../devel/py-test-cov
1.1       wiz        33:
1.7       wiz        34: PYTHON_VERSIONS_INCOMPATIBLE=  27
1.8       wiz        35: REPLACE_PYTHON+=       bin/todo
1.1       wiz        36: USE_LANGUAGES= # none
                     37:
1.8       wiz        38: # overwrite automatically generated file with recommended one, per
                     39: # "Notes for Packagers" in documentation
                     40: post-install:
                     41:        ${INSTALL_SCRIPT} ${WRKSRC}/bin/todo ${DESTDIR}${PREFIX}/bin
                     42:
                     43: .include "../../lang/python/application.mk"
1.1       wiz        44: .include "../../lang/python/egg.mk"
                     45: .include "../../mk/bsd.pkg.mk"
1.12    ! wiz        46: # needed due to py-click
        !            47: TEST_ENV+=     LC_ALL=en_US.UTF-8

CVSweb <webmaster@jp.NetBSD.org>